a. What is a blog? Write the names any two types of blogs.
Answer: Blog is a short form of WEBLOG, which refers to a website where new information about any topic is updated regularly. The latest posts appear first. The term Weblog was coined by an American blogger named Jorn Barger in 1997. It is like a journal where we write about our life and thoughts. It is more like a personal diary which is shared online publicly.
The two types of blogs are travel blog and fitness blog.

d. Write the differences between Blog and Website.
Answer: A blog is a type of website that typically contains regularly updated content, often in the form of written articles or posts. A website, on the other hand, can be any type of online presence that provides information to its visitors. Here are some key differences between blogs and websites:- Purpose: A blog is usually focused on a specific topic or theme, and the content is typically presented in a chronological order with the most recent posts appearing first. A website, on the other hand, can be used for a wide variety of purposes and may not have a specific theme or focus.
- Content: Blogs often have a mix of text, images, and other media, and the content is typically created by one or more individuals. Websites can also have a mix of content, but they may also include more static information such as company profiles or product descriptions.
- Interactivity: Blogs often have features that allow visitors to interact with the content, such as the ability to leave comments or subscribe to updates. Websites may also have interactive features, but they are not always a primary focus.
- Frequency of updates: Blogs are typically updated regularly, often daily or weekly. Websites may also be updated regularly, but the update frequency can vary depending on the purpose of the website.
